How to turn a document into a video
To turn a document into a video, upload it to an AI document-to-video tool like FlickDoc. The tool reads the document — whether it's a PDF, Word file, or PowerPoint — and automatically generates a narrated, animated video that teaches its content. No scripting, recording, or video editing is required.

Which documents can be converted
FlickDoc converts PDF, DOCX (Word), TXT, and PPTX (PowerPoint) files into video. This covers most business content — handbooks, SOPs, policies, technical docs, training material, and slide decks.
What the AI does for you
The AI extracts the document's structure and key ideas, breaks it into scenes, writes and voices narration, and generates animated visuals timed to the narration. The result is a complete video produced from the document alone, without any manual production steps.
